Oatmeal is a preparation of oats that have been dehusked, steamed, and flattened, or a coarse flour of hulled oat grains (groats) that have either been milled (ground), rolled, or steel-cut. Oatmeal can support your blood sugar regulation, weight management, and heart health. It's a source of antioxidants, fiber, and whole grains.
